Haven Kaye (11 June 1846 – 24 January 1892) was an English first-class cricketer, who played eight matches for Yorkshire County Cricket Club in 1872 and 1873. A right-handed batsman, he scored 117 runs at 8.35, with a highest score of 33, made against Surrey. He also took three catches, but was not called upon to bowl his right arm, round arm, fast medium.
